Description : African art. Ivory Coast- Dan Mask Hard wood with glossy patina, black pigment and metal. Signs of use.. A beautiful and honest Dan mask of the Deangle type, characterised by slit eyes framed in aluminium. The metal used helps to place this mask in a time space that is not particularly old, but this mask with its full and balanced volumes does not appear to have been artificially aged in any of its parts. The patina of the black paint with which it has been repeatedly painted contains small traces of red, the legacy of who knows what history, and on the back it is skilfully sculpted by man and beautifully polished by wear and time. The many uneven holes surrounding the face, some of which are still inhabited by insects, suggest that she was once dressed for dancing, and even her shortcomings, such as the ritual iron on her forehead, contribute to testifying to her honesty.. Cm 15,50 x 24,00 x 7,00.
